I'd like to make a dual siege map. For this, I need terrain of middle earth, preferably with realistic elevations. If no one feels up to the task, I will do it myself, but I've no true skills with terrain as a good majority of you who will probably read this have. For that reason, I'm appealing to you for help. Should my map come to fruition, you will be be fully credited, and have some input into the actual finished product if you'd like.

Like it or not, many people like Heavens Last Stand. It's a decent siege map. I'd like to push this one step further, maybe more chaotic than it CAN be, but I'd like to try a dual siege map. On the one end, you have the Dagorlad, the Morannon, and Barad-Dur as your final destination. On the other, Ithilien, Osgiliath, Minas Tirith being your final destination. Siege of Barad-Dur would be 2nd age, during the time of the Last Alliance. Siege of Minas Tirith would be 3rd age, during the War of the Ring.

Using these locations, I have the idea of creating a story where some kind of time rift allows passage to the 3rd age or the 2nd age by heros on each team. For an elf like Elrond, there would be little difference, but say if Aragorn goes from the 3rd age to the 2nd age, he transforms into his ancestor ( most likely would use Elendil, though Isildur would work as well I suppose ).
